@charset "UTF-8";

.mediation-accordion-box .accordion-box + .accordion-box {margin-top: 24px;}
.mediation-accordion-box .accordion-box .tit-box {position: relative; display: flex; align-items: center; height:62px; padding-left:24px; padding-right: 78px; border-radius: 8px; background: #F3F8FF; border:1px solid #C6C6C6; cursor: pointer;}
.mediation-accordion-box .accordion-box .tit-box::after {content:''; position: absolute; top:16px; right:24px; width: 30px; height: 30px; background: url(/static/imgs/common/ico_accordion_arrow_2.svg) no-repeat 0 0 /100%; transform: rotate(180deg); transition: all .3s ease;}
.mediation-accordion-box .accordion-box .tit-box .tit {color:#0065E8; font-size: 18px; line-height: 27px; font-weight: 700;}
.mediation-accordion-box .accordion-box .toggle-box {border: 1px solid #C6C6C6; border-radius: 0 0 8px 8px; padding:32px;}
.mediation-accordion-box .accordion-box .toggle-box .item-box > * {margin-bottom:0;}
.mediation-accordion-box .accordion-box .toggle-box .item-box {display: flex; flex-direction: column; gap:16px;}
.mediation-accordion-box .accordion-box .toggle-box .item-box .img-box .arrow {flex:none; display: block; width:40px; height:20px; background: url(/static/imgs/common/ico_arrow_blue.svg) no-repeat 0 0 /100%;}
.mediation-accordion-box .accordion-box .toggle-box .item-box .img-box {display: flex; justify-content: center; align-items: center; padding:32px 40px; border-radius: 16px; background: #F8F8F8; border:1px solid #E8E8E8; gap:30px;}
.mediation-accordion-box .accordion-box .toggle-box .item-box .img-box img {flex:1;}
.mediation-accordion-box .accordion-box .toggle-box .item-box .img-box .img-txt {display: flex; align-self: flex-end; align-items: center; flex-direction: column; flex:210px 0 0; height:100%;}
.mediation-accordion-box .accordion-box .toggle-box .item-box .img-box .img-txt .txt {width:100%; margin-top: 16px; display: flex; justify-content: center; align-items: center; height:32px; gap:8px; border: 1px solid #CFD8DC; box-shadow: 2px 2px 4px 0px rgba(0, 0, 0, 0.08); border-radius: 20px; font-size: 16px; line-height: 24px; font-weight: 700; color:#002352;}
.mediation-accordion-box .accordion-box .toggle-box .item-box .img-box .img-txt .txt::before {content:''; display: block; width: 6px; height: 6px; border-radius: 6px; background: #CFD8DC;}
.mediation-accordion-box .accordion-box .toggle-box .item-box .img-box .img-txt .txt::after {content:''; display: block; width: 6px; height: 6px; border-radius: 6px; background: #CFD8DC;}

.mediation-accordion-box .accordion-box .toggle-box .item-box span.replace-txt {font-size: 18px; letter-spacing: -0.9px; font-weight: 700;}

.mediation-accordion-box .accordion-box .toggle-box .item-box + .item-box {margin-top: 24px; padding-top: 24px; border-top: 1px dashed #C6C6C6;}
.mediation-accordion-box .accordion-box .toggle-box .pc {display: block;}
.mediation-accordion-box .accordion-box .toggle-box .m {display: none;}
.mediation-accordion-box .accordion-box .toggle-box {display: none;}

.mediation-accordion-box .accordion-box.active .toggle-box {display: block;}
.mediation-accordion-box .accordion-box.active .tit-box {background: linear-gradient(0deg, #00B9FF, #00B9FF), linear-gradient(92.06deg, #0065E8 -13.39%, #0099DB 92.18%); border:none; border-radius: 8px 8px 0 0;}
.mediation-accordion-box .accordion-box.active .tit-box::after {transform: rotate(0);}
.mediation-accordion-box .accordion-box.active .tit-box .tit {color:#FFF;}

.list-txt li + li {margin-top: 16px;}
.list-txt li {display: flex; gap:8px; flex-wrap:wrap;}
.list-txt li .num {margin-top: 2px; flex:none; display: flex; justify-content: center; align-items: center; width: 20px; height: 20px; background: #FCD7E2; border-radius: 10px; font-size: 13px; line-height: 20px; font-weight: 400;}
.list-txt li .txt-list {flex:calc(100% - 30px); font-size: 18px; line-height: 26px; font-weight: 400;}
.list-txt li .txt-secondary4 {font-size: 16px; line-height: 24px;}

@media (max-width: 1024px) {
    .mediation-accordion-box .accordion-box .toggle-box .item-box {align-items: center;}
    .mediation-accordion-box .accordion-box .toggle-box .item-box .img-box {flex-direction: column; gap:24px;}
    .mediation-accordion-box .accordion-box .toggle-box .item-box .img-box .arrow {transform: rotate(90deg);}

    .mediation-accordion-box .accordion-box .toggle-box .item-box .dh02 {width: 100%;}
}

@media (max-width: 765px) {

    .mediation-accordion-box .accordion-box .tit-box {height:56px; padding:0 56px 0 16px;}
    .mediation-accordion-box .accordion-box .tit-box::after {right:16px; width: 24px; height: 24px;}
    .mediation-accordion-box .accordion-box .toggle-box .pc {display: none;}
    .mediation-accordion-box .accordion-box .toggle-box .m {display: block;}
    .mediation-accordion-box .accordion-box.active .toggle-box {padding:16px;}
    .mediation-accordion-box .accordion-box .tit-box .tit {font-size: 16px; line-height: 24px;}
    .mediation-accordion-box .accordion-box + .accordion-box {margin-top: 16px;}
    .mediation-accordion-box .accordion-box .toggle-box .item-box .img-box .img-txt {width:100%;}

    .list-txt li .num {margin-top: 0;}
    .list-txt li .txt-list {font-size: 14px; line-height: 20px; font-weight: 400;}
    .list-txt li .txt-secondary4 {font-size: 14px; line-height: 20px;}

    .mediation-accordion-box .accordion-box .toggle-box .item-box span.replace-txt {font-size: 14px;}
}